2. Never Split the Difference: Negotiating as if Your Life Depended on It by Chris Voss

Amazon rating: About 4.7 out of 5 stars from more than 51,000 reviews

Former FBI hostage negotiator Chris Voss shares high-stakes techniques—tactical empathy, calibrated questions, and labeling—that transfer directly to business negotiations, salary discussions, sales, and daily conversations.

This title frequently ranks at or near the top of Amazon’s Communication Skills bestsellers. Readers praise the practical tools and real-world stories that help them achieve better outcomes without damaging relationships.

5. Influence, New and Expanded: The Psychology of Persuasion by Robert B. Cialdini

Amazon rating: Approximately 4.7 out of 5 stars from nearly 8,000 reviews on the expanded edition

Robert Cialdini explains the science of persuasion through principles such as reciprocity, social proof, authority, and scarcity. The expanded edition includes updated research and examples.

Amazon readers in sales, marketing, leadership, and everyday life value the clear insights that help them influence others ethically and recognize persuasion tactics used on them.

6. Nonviolent Communication: A Language of Life by Marshall B. Rosenberg

Amazon rating: About 4.7 out of 5 stars from over 12,000 reviews

Marshall Rosenberg’s four-step process—observations, feelings, needs, and requests—helps reduce conflict and build deeper connections. It shifts communication from blame to empathy and clarity.

Buyers often describe the book as transformative for both personal relationships and workplace interactions, praising the practical examples that foster mutual understanding.
